找回密码
 注册

QQ登录

只需一步,快速开始

扫一扫,访问微社区

巢课
电巢直播8月计划

这个CPU的地址线为啥不是从0为开始的?

查看数: 1108 | 评论数: 6 | 收藏 0
关灯 | 提示:支持键盘翻页<-左 右->
    组图打开中,请稍候......
发布时间: 2010-12-9 17:59

正文摘要:

见图9 v7 D) d# A7 @" S $ l/ G; Q% w- [5 L

回复

qiangqssong 发表于 2011-6-1 17:10
3楼、4楼的正解!!!
somnus9 发表于 2011-6-1 15:36
学习了!!!
fueagle 发表于 2011-5-21 14:35
看看,不解
liqiangln 发表于 2010-12-14 12:54
其实这个问题比较简单,如果你有100个箱子(0-99),你一次拿8个箱子,第一次你拿的是0-7,这个时候你就需要起始编号就好了0x00(0),第二次你就从第8个开始拿了吧(8~15),这个时候起始编码是0x08(8),第三次其实编码是0x0F(16),如果你把这些16进制的数换成2进制的话,你会看到最低位编号没变换,根本就不关心。你问的问题,跟我说的这个例子很接近,自己再想想。
1 e4 d# D* y7 G) K  O
" ]( ]4 n! Y- q$ ]6 L所以数据线是16bit,是从ADD1开始
, Y3 t0 D) M5 G) J/ h( C+ W  i32bit是从ADD2开始,
8 z3 N* }- j  i+ B1 P4 H  |CPU的最小操作是1个byte 8bit.

评分

参与人数 1贡献 +5 收起 理由
mikle517 + 5 浅显易懂,多谢了!

查看全部评分

00750 发表于 2010-12-9 20:31
本帖最后由 00750 于 2010-12-9 20:40 编辑
  n3 U, C4 Q; c% I5 ?# v3 h# }; ^' H0 b
这个跟CPU有关系,当32位接口接16位外设时,这种CPU会按这样的顺序组织数据。类推一下,如果接8位的外设,那么数据总线应该是DATA[31:24].
mikle517 发表于 2010-12-9 18:00
发图老是看不清楚啊* F1 O% _0 X- W$ s7 g! `- r
关闭

推荐内容上一条 /1 下一条

巢课

技术风云榜

关于我们|手机版|EDA365 ( 粤ICP备18020198号 )

GMT+8, 2024-12-5 03:51 , Processed in 0.063316 second(s), 38 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表